The San Joaquin Memorial Panthers will head out to square off against the Piedmont Highlanders at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day. San Joaquin Memorial has been getting the ball to fall more lately as they've increased their point totals each of their last three games.
San Joaquin Memorial is on a roll after a high-stakes playoff matchup on Tuesday. They came out on top against Folsom by a score of 84-74. The win was all the more spectacular given the Panthers' disadvantage in MaxPreps' California basketball rankings (they are ranked 77th, while the Bulldogs are ranked 13th).
Oakland Tech typically has all the answers at home, but on Tuesday Piedmont proved too difficult a challenge. They blew past the Bulldogs, posting a 60-29 victory. The Highlanders have made a habit of sweeping their opponents off the court, having now won 13 contests by 22 points or more this season.
San Joaquin Memorial is on a roll lately: they've won ten of their last 11 games. That's provided a nice bump to their 23-6 record this season. The wins came thanks in part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 62.5 points over those games. The win made it two in a row for Piedmont and bumps their season record up to 24-5.
